Kam Wah Cafe & Cake Shop
Chinese restaurant
3.7
Old-school cha chaan teng known for fresh bakeries. Grab a Hong Kong or Portuguese egg tart. Don't miss the boluo bao.

Hung Hom Pancake
Snack bar
3.9
Local legend open for over 40 years. Try the savory egg waffle with pork floss. Don't miss the pancake with cream and fresh mangoes.

Milkfill
Bakery
4.6
Airy Napoleon puffs with unique cream fillings. Try the bruleed pineapple or pistachio. Expect a rich, less-sweet treat.

MOROPAIN HK
Bakery
4.1
Try the tiramisu melon bread bun. It combines tiramisu inside a crispy melon bun. A rich and sweet treat for tiramisu lovers.

Cheun Wo Pastry
Bakery
2.3
Must-try mango mochi. Two juicy mangoes tucked inside a stretchy mochi exterior. A refreshing and popular dessert.
